Make sure that your Netgear wireless range extender and your home router are connected properly. If the Ethernet cable connecting your devices is worn out, get it replaced with a new one immediately!
Also, ensure that the connection between your WiFi devices is finger-tight. Once assured, try to log in to your Netgear extender using 192.168.1.250 default IP.

If none of the aforementioned tips helped you resolve the 192.168.1.250 IP not working issue, then the culprit might be the firewall installed on your device.
Sometimes, antivirus software or the firewall security can stop you from accessing certain websites. In order to get the issue fixed, we recommend you temporarily disable the firewall on your device.
If you are not able to log in to your Netgear extender using the default IP, consider opting for the default web address. The default web address of Netgear extenders is mywifiext.
Enter it in the address bar of the web browser and wait for a few seconds to get redirected to the Netgear extender administrative page.
Note: Do not enter the default web address of your Netgear wireless range extender into the search bar of your web browser.
